本视频教程深入解析负载平衡,探讨其背后的原因和面临的挑战,并提供了高效解决方案,旨在帮助观众全面理解负载平衡及其在提升系统性能和稳定性方面的关键作用。
本文目录导读:
在当今的互联网时代,随着数据量的激增和用户需求的多样化,负载平衡已成为现代网络架构中不可或缺的一部分,负载平衡不仅可以提高系统性能,还可以保障系统的稳定性和可靠性,本视频教程将深入探讨负载平衡的原因、挑战以及高效解决方案。
负载平衡的原因
1、提高系统性能:负载平衡可以将用户请求均匀分配到多个服务器上,从而提高系统整体的处理能力,避免单个服务器过载。
2、保障系统可靠性:通过负载平衡,当某台服务器出现故障时,其他服务器可以接管其任务,确保系统正常运行。
3、降低成本:负载平衡可以充分利用服务器资源,避免资源浪费,降低系统运维成本。
图片来源于网络,如有侵权联系删除
4、改善用户体验:负载平衡可以减少响应时间,提高用户访问速度,提升用户体验。
负载平衡的挑战
1、资源分配不均:负载平衡需要合理分配服务器资源,避免出现部分服务器过载,部分服务器空闲的情况。
2、网络延迟:负载平衡需要考虑网络延迟对系统性能的影响,避免将请求分配到延迟较高的服务器。
3、故障转移:在负载平衡过程中,如何实现故障转移,确保系统稳定性,是负载平衡需要解决的问题。
4、安全性问题:负载平衡过程中,需要确保数据传输的安全性,防止数据泄露。
图片来源于网络,如有侵权联系删除
负载平衡的解决方案
1、使用负载均衡器:负载均衡器可以将请求分发到多个服务器,实现负载平衡,常见的负载均衡器有Nginx、HAProxy等。
2、虚拟化技术:通过虚拟化技术,可以将物理服务器虚拟成多个虚拟机,实现负载平衡,虚拟化技术如KVM、Xen等。
3、分布式存储:分布式存储可以将数据存储在多个节点上,实现负载均衡,常见的分布式存储系统有HDFS、Ceph等。
4、容器化技术:容器化技术可以将应用程序打包成容器,实现快速部署和扩展,常见的容器化技术有Docker、Kubernetes等。
5、优化网络配置:通过优化网络配置,降低网络延迟,提高负载平衡效果,如使用CDN、优化DNS解析等。
图片来源于网络,如有侵权联系删除
6、实现故障转移:通过监控服务器状态,实现故障转移,常见的故障转移方案有双机热备、高可用集群等。
7、强化安全性:在负载平衡过程中,采用SSL/TLS加密、防火墙等安全措施,保障数据传输的安全性。
负载平衡在现代网络架构中具有重要意义,本视频教程从原因、挑战及解决方案等方面进行了深入剖析,通过学习本教程,读者可以更好地了解负载平衡技术,为实际项目提供有力支持,在实施负载平衡时,应根据实际情况选择合适的方案,确保系统性能、可靠性和安全性。
评论列表